Please try out this new. Large collection of code snippets for HTML, CSS and JavaScript. This React project can be customized with additional features like scorekeeping, and multiplayer functionality, and you can style it with CSS. . We can combine the two by making the React state be the “single source of truth”. js, Next. It uses only JavaScript to build a cross-platform mobile app. This example uses an XML-like syntax called JSX. js. Here is a collection of React syntax and usage that you can use as a handy guide or reference. Lets switch back to Visual Studio Code. How To's. JavaScript & JavaScript with ASP. value, Name:this. This tutorial starts with the architecture of React, how-to guide to. With &&, you could conditionally render the checkmark only if isPacked is true: return (. With Hooks, you can extract stateful logic from a component so it can be tested independently and reused. We will see Introduction to React in Hindi in 2020. You can inject value into props as given below:These are the basic operations for databases. RT @swapnakpanda: Best YouTube channels for Web Dev: HTML/CSS Kevin Powell JavaScript developedbyed Java amigoscode C# kudvenkat PHP ProgramWithGio Python Corey. Conditional rendering in React works the same way conditions work in JavaScript. What is Routing?2. 1 with useNavigate The useHistory() hook is now deprecated. Creating a React Element is Cheap compared to DOM elements. Then, you can render only some of them, depending on the state of your application. js, we import a Provider from react-redux, and the newly created store like so: import { Provider } from "react-redux"; import configureStore from "store"; Provider: makes the Redux store available to any nested components that have been wrapped in the connect function;Many React-based frameworks are full-stack and let your React app take advantage of the server. . We can think of useEffect Hook as componentDidMount, componentDidUpdate, and componentWillUnmount combined. Understanding DOM. 21. Please feel free to share the link of this page with your friends and family. This is one of the best React JS projects for beginners to implement React concepts like state management, conditional rendering, and event handling. We’ve created a Working Group to prepare the community for gradual adoption of new features in React 18. Originally built by Facebook, Meta and the open-source community now maintain it. Getting started with MongoDB database. The create-react-app tool is an officially supported way to create React applications. REACT JS: Map over an array of objects to render in JSX. What are Custom Hooks in React2. Lets create our first React Element using JSX. For your convenience, we have arranged all the JavaScript videos in a logical sequence using youtube playlists. React Installation and Setup2. 15. Complete Master Detail CRUD Operations with Asp. Saat ini (2020), Reactjs berada di posisi rangking 1 diantara pesaingnya. more. The 6-build-the-best-ecommerce-website-ever-with-react-js-next-js-redux-toolkit-and-next-auth have 0 and 3. NPM Commands for React. When not writing about technical topics, he also shares his thoughts on Entrepreneurship, Indie Hacking, and Side Projects. Stream and Download DRM-free files from any device. ReactJS tutorial provides basic and advanced concepts of ReactJS. React JS tutorial for beginners | Learn React JS online free. In my previous experience, I found tutorials/courses that put API calls in a services folder. A typical React app will have many components like header component, navbar component, footer component. How to cre. com Free Programming Books Disclaimer This is an uno cial free book created for educational purposes and is not a liated with o cial React JS group(s) or company(s). Once that’s done, we can get started with our React app by running this command: npx create-react-app nav-bar. js. React is the library for web and native user interfaces. js, and paste them inside Form () 's return statement. Example built with Angular 10. It makes the code wait until the promise returns a result. kudvenkat. Tutorial Series: How To Code in React. js) is one of the most popular JavaScript front end development libraries. js — React — Vue. RT @swapnakpanda: Best YouTube channels for Web Dev: HTML/CSS Kevin Powell JavaScript developedbyed Java amigoscode C# kudvenkat PHP ProgramWithGio Python Corey. . . Developers define components in React by using an HTML-like syntax called JSX. Familiarity with both HTML and JavaScript will help you to learn JSX, and better identify whether bugs in your application are related to JavaScript or to the more specific domain of React. createElement function every time, even if you are just adding a simple div. js. NET Web API Bootstrap AngularJS Tutorial jQuery Tutorial JavaScript with ASP. This tutorial starts with the architecture of Angular 8,setup simple project, data binding, then walks through forms, templates, routing and explains about AYour React application begins at a “root” component. if you are using React Router and your component is rendered by a Route like below for example: <Route exact path='/' component={HomeComponent}/> that component will automatically receive three objects from Route named history, location and match respectively. Quick Contact𝗕𝗼𝗼𝘀𝘁 𝗬𝗼𝘂𝗿 𝗙𝗶𝗴𝗺𝗮 𝗦𝗸𝗶𝗹𝗹𝘀 𝘄𝗶𝘁𝗵 𝗧𝗵𝗲𝘀𝗲 𝗦𝗵𝗼𝗿𝘁𝗰𝘂𝘁𝘀! 🚀 Ever felt like you could be. It combines to. If the user clicks the To do button, only the items with a done value of false show. Enroll now and learn wcf step by step. Since ours is a Web App, lets install react-router-dom from our node js command Prompt. js by Anton Shaleynikov brings Vue into the conversation for the best JavaScript framework and walks readers through the installation (including CLI) process for React. $ 50. So for every object that exists in the original DOM, there is an object for that in React Virtual DOM. js or Razzle. Step 1. Language: English. by: KudVenkat in: Free Online CoursesShare your videos with friends, family, and the worldReactJS Fundamentals-1. Happy learning. This post is a brief summary of it, so if you. React JS is a powerful and versatile library that enables developers to build sophisticated web applications. You can control changes by adding event handlers in the onChange attribute. Google Trends: Comparison between React JS vs Angular in the last 12 months and 5 years. How to handle exceptions in Component class render methods, lifecycle methods3. Sencha offers one of the best React frameworks for grids. How to Create Reusable function in React4. Net MVC, ASP. Step 1. In that case, serve the HTML/CSS/JS export (next export output for Next. The action-type and the action data are always stored in the action object. Objective: To set up a local React development environment, create a. React is the library for web and native user interfaces. Get 2 Best Visual Studio Code Extensions Build The Best Facebook Clone With React Js Mern Stack 2022 MP3 For Nothing in Houston Press Music uploaded by Dev7. 1 (April 2022). Net Core W. webpack is a module bundler that lets you compile JavaScript modules. Create React App is a well-established, reliable. React (also known as React. This course is designed for begi. PDF Version. I strongly believe the best gift that we can give is "The Gift of Education". It can be a value of any type. Let’s get back to App. What is Routing?2. kudvenkat. In summary, here are 10 of our most popular react js courses. (Just like these docs!) It is declarative, meaning that you write the code that you want and React takes that declared code and performs all of the JavaScript/DOM steps to get the desired result. Actually, it is a JavaScript Engine backed by Google Chrome. js is the most popular front-end JavaScript library for building Web applications. It comes with simple configuration, and explicit directives and promotes best practices. It is initialized with the reducer function and the initial state object. js project, run in your terminal: Terminal. CSS Framework. 6. . NET Web API Bootstrap AngularJS Tutorial jQuery Tutorial JavaScript with ASP. Facebook Software Engineer, Jordan Walke, created it. A minifier that performs dead-code elimination such as UglifyJS is recommended to completely remove the extra code. Building an app or preparing for a JavaScript interview? Watch this ES6 tutorial to learn ES6 quickly. They let you use state and other React features without writing a class. You’ll work with React specific concepts like: JSX, components, state, props, hooks, and more. React v17. React will only call this function after a click. React Installation and Setup 2. by that you can find what you asked under location. Components. KudVenkat. 50,000. This may take a few minutes to create the React application and install its dependencies. Let's gift education together Please find all the free c# video tutorials from the basics to advanced topics. 1 web application. net web forms etc Sir, please post many other videos on jquery , angularjs etc Sir , you possess very strong background in e-commerce websites , also. In order to integrate React with a . Share your videos with friends, family, and the worldTry this online React Playground with instant live preview and console. This is an extension for React and Next. Clicking the buttons changes the filter values, which determines the items that show as well as the styles that Angular applies to the active button. •. dev for the new React docs. ReactJS…New to React? Here are great, free resources! Read the official Getting Started page on the docs /u/acemarke's suggested resources for learning React; Kent Dodds' Egghead. Current version of create-react-app is v5. 0+ version. 🔥ReactJS Training - Edureka React JS Tutorial for Beginners will help you learn ReactJS conc. filter(u => u. Inevitably, this means that no matter where functions and variables are declared, they are moved to the top of their scope regardless of whether. React uses an HTML-in-JavaScript syntax called JSX (JavaScript and XML). I strongly believe the best gift that we can give is "The Gift of Education". Summary Features of ReactJS JSX : JSX is an extension to javascript. Rendering Elements using ContainerText version of the videoIn this video we will discuss1. listUsers = this. Create your own React libraries or Contribute to open-source projects. createElement call. ReactJS Tutorial. key - as you already know, each dynamically created React component instance needs a key property that React uses to uniquely identify that instance. js npx create. How to Configure Stripe: To create a Stripe account, go to this URL. Copy the <form> tags and everything between them from inside App. maintain a proper import structure (third-party imports first --> internal imports below) format your code before committing. And make sure the the file is exposed (not packed). The share of Vue. Node. React Tutorial is suitable for developers with JavaScript experience. It is simple, single-command web publishing. React is an open-source JavaScript library for building front end user interfaces. React is a JavaScript library for building user interfaces, while React JS is a framework built on top of React that provides a more complete solution for building complex applications. NET web. . We’re displaying the current value of the counter to the users and let them change it by interacting with the two buttons. css holds global styles that are applied to our whole app. Enrollment: Anyone.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"README. The state in a component can change over time, and whenever it changes, the component re-renders. The only JavaScript UI toolbox you will ever need, Kendo UI helps developers easily build complex web apps with native UI components for Angular, React, Vue and jQuery. 3 Answers. json debugger configuration file. 2. CSS framework Browser Statistics. React. Read long term trends of browser usage. Enroll Dates: Enroll Anytime. Go to react. Exercise 1 Exercise 2 Exercise 3 Exercise 4 Go to React CSS Styling Tutorial. In React, form data is usually handled by the components. Run the React Application. In this example, the ChatRoom component uses an Effect to stay connected to an external system defined in chat. This has been kept for security reason. Other versions available: Angular Template-Driven Forms: Angular 10 Next. Siguiente (en-US) En este artículo conoceremos React. One of the best aspects of React JS is JSX, it allows writing the building blocks extremely simple for developers. js, Java, C#, etc. Currently, ReactJS is one of the most popular JavaScript front-end libraries which has a strong foundation and a large community. Read long term trends of browser usage. js file, as well as the power of ECMAScript (especially from 6+) and some good old patterns, you can. React Js learnt from Kudvenkat. Now you are ready to run your first real React application! Run this command to move to the my-react-app directory: cd my-react-app. log('click')} is a common mistake, and would fire every time the component re-renders. js file, as well as the power of ECMAScript (especially from 6+) and some good old patterns, you can create complex web applications from scratch, reusing as many components you need. Angular 2 is an open source JavaScript framework to build web applications in HTML and JavaScript. React uses Virtual DOM exists which is like a lightweight copy of the actual DOM (a virtual representation of the DOM). Logical && Operator. . RT @swapnakpanda: Best YouTube channels for Web Dev: HTML/CSS Kevin Powell JavaScript developedbyed Java amigoscode C# kudvenkat PHP ProgramWithGio Python Corey. Weekly $3,855. . Build fast and responsive sites using our free W3. pathname // we will get the. This is another good website to learn about Reactjs online. Learn in an interactive environment. in this react js tutorial for beginners series we learn what is react js and how to learn it , topics of react js in this complete playlist. I have created thousands of software training video tutorials and made them avai. js Admin Template – is the most developer-friendly 🤘🏻 & highly customizable React Admin Dashboard Template based on React. NET Tutorial JavaScript. What you will learn. It could be used within the async block only. Then do the following: cd react-multilevel-dropdown-menu npm start. It enables the navigation among views of various components in a React Application, allows changing the browser URL, and keeps the UI in sync with the URL. A component is combination of. In this application, we need to perform CRUD operations on multiple resources, therefore multiple pages. Familiarity with both HTML and JavaScript will help you to learn JSX, and better identify whether bugs in your application are related to JavaScript or to the more. Fetching is simple and straight forward, react-query provides a hook called useQuery which takes a key and function responsible for fetching data. Quick Guide. It is a a development server that uses Webpack to compile React, JSX, and ES6, auto-prefix CSS files. Some of them were: use functional components (like arrow-functions) don't use inline-styles. Ajax is a programming concept. It works best to build user interfaces by combining sections of code (components) into full websites. . Learn React: Scrimba. React is a popular JavaScript framework for creating front-end applications, such as user interfaces that allow users to interact with programs. These new documentation pages teach modern React: react: Hooks. 5 Upgrade Guide. And thanks to a new packaging strategy that compiles away process. In HTML, form elements such as <input>, <textarea>, and <select> typically maintain their own state and update it based on user input. Build user interfaces out of individual pieces called components written in JavaScript. In this video we will discuss 1. Go to react. Babel is a popular tool for using the newest features of the JavaScript programming language. js in 2021; Web traffic redirection with Node and Express on CentOS8; Building a MQTT Interface; Server Rendering with. Choose Web App (Edge) from the Select debugger dropdown list. Integrating this with your existing react component can be done in a number of ways - one approach might be as follows: /* Definition of handleClick in component */ handleClick = (event) => { /* call prompt () with custom message to get user input from alert-like dialog */ const enteredName = prompt ('Please enter your name') /* update state of. - React is an open source Javascript library used for creating dynamic and interactive user interface for mobile and web applications"," - React JS effectively handles view(UI) layer. React. Note: by default, React will be in development mode. They speed up the procedure of turning a notion for an online project into reality. Details of #6 BUILD THE BEST ECOMMERCE WEBSITE EVER WITH REACT. Over 150,000 subscribers from over 100 countries on my Youtube channel. Inside React components, it often comes up when you want to render some JSX when the condition is true, or render nothing otherwise. This blog site has been archived. In the above example, we have written a counter example. 8. I have some PORT and APIs inside . Hooks allow you to reuse stateful logic without changing your component hierarchy. In HTML, form elements such as <input>, <textarea>, and <select> typically maintain their own state and update it based on user input. js. Libraries & Frameworks: Learn about libraries like Axios or frameworks like React. It can be used for an authentication system and can also be used for information exchange. On the other hand, React solely uses JSX. env. Go to react. Our goal. I've been learning React for a couple days now and it's been great thanks to this resource: Learn React interactively with React Tutorial It's great that something of such quality is available (the first 10 chapters are free) thanks to @JoubranJad I strongly believe the best gift that we can give is "The Gift of Education". This ultimate React 101 is an interactive course to learn React. This is an extension for React and Next. First, import useState from React: import { useState } from 'react'; Now you can declare a state variable inside your component: function MyButton() {. addons. React. In this react js tutorial for beginners series we learn what is useMemo Hook in react js and how to learn it with interview questions in react js. CSS framework Browser Statistics. js development. js, Node. However, you can use the same approach even if you can’t or don’t want to run JavaScript on the server. I strongly believe the best gift that we can give is "The Gift of Education". How to Implement Routing in React Project3. For example, if MyComponents. Not comfortable with JavaScript? Check out Learn JavaScript. 📘 Courses - Support UPI - Support PayPal - Github. React vs. AngularJS was designed from ground up to be testable. You will also modify the default project to create your base project by mapping over a list of emojis and adding a small amount of styling. Configure the debugger. What are Error Boundaries in React2. These new documentation pages teach modern React: memo: Skipping re-rendering when props are unchanged. Now lets add a new Element called as React. NET Tutorial JavaScript Tutorial Charts. This React project is a clone of hacker news rewritten with universal JavaScript, using React and GraphQL. 코어 HTML, CSS, 및. PRAGIM is known for placements in major IT companies. This means that the better you are at JavaScript, the more successful you will be with React. React is a front-end library in Javascript that was developed by Facebook. . React is an open source, JavaScript library for developing user interface (UI) in web application. Building the board . Usually, it is created automatically when you start a new project. In React, components are built using a JSX syntax that combines. The image above depicts the exact same code written in JSX and with React. React Native is an open-source mobile application framework while React is for websites (front-end). Framework ini memang lagi populer. This is another great resource to learn React. js file from src folder. js Full. Here we create a simple list of Items to be managed using these CRUD operations. Net Core Web API. The token is mainly composed of header, payload, signature. In this react js tutorial for beginners series we learn what is useMemo Hook in react js and how to learn it with interview questions in react js. New Course Enquiry : +1908 356 4312. npx create-next-app@latest. . KudVenkat. •. Lets call useEffect function and it takes one callback function as a parameter. Main differences between Reactjs and React Native. React is the entry point to the React library. Open your terminal in the directory you would like to create your application. createFragment, deprecated. create-react-app includes built tools such as webpack, Babel, and ESLint. Applying Styles using CSS. Download Source Code. Course Dates: March 16, 2021 - No End Date. You can place an individual. This is going to be a project-based course full of real-world reac. By default, Vue utilizes HTML templates, but there is an alternative to transcribing in JSX. In React JS, React is the base abstraction of React DOM for the web platform, while with React Native, React is still the base abstraction but of React Native. React Js learnt from Kudvenkat. It only makes the async block wait. React is designed to let you seamlessly combine components written by independent people, teams, and organizations. DatePicker is a component, you can use it directly from JSX with: import React from 'react'; const MyComponents = { DatePicker: function DatePicker(props. Create React App. kudvenkat. Use the full power of JavaScript with ASP. If you wish to receive email alerts when new articles, videos or interview questions are posted on PragimTech. js faster. One option would be to use the prompt () function, which displays a modal dialog through which user input can be entered and acquired. KudVenkat. Implementing Authentication. The prompt (). Please click on the respective links below to start learning. React Js learnt from Kudvenkat. Major MNC's visit PRAGIM campus every week for interviews. . If you’re new to Next. All trademarks and registered trademarks are the property of their respective owners 100+ pagesOptimizing Performance. When the data is handled by the components, all the data is stored in the component state. So React, will convert this JSX to the below code: React. Template using HTML. GRUI by Sencha makes React app development with grids quick and easy by offering high-performance. For SSR with React and Node. Whether you want to get a taste of React, add some interactivity to an HTML page, or start a complex React-powered app, this section will help you get started.